     gene            1..1269
                     /gene="ATHB54"
                     /locus_tag="AT1G27045"
                     /gene_synonym="HB54; homeobox protein 54"
                     /note="Encodes ATHB54, a member of the homeodomain leucine
                     zipper (HD-Zip) family protein. Please note that this
                     locus was split from AT1G27050 in the TAIR10 genome
                     release (2010). Affymetrix ATH1 Probe Set linked to symbol
                     ATHB54 is in fact directed against the product of the
                     AT1G27050 locus (the mRNA coding for the
                     RNA-recognition-motif protein)."
